Andy Murray may have revolutionized the "Want Ads" process.

According to tennis.si.com, Murray indirectly posted an ad for a new coach, in the form of asking his Twitter followers whom they would choose as their coach, if they could select anyone.

Murray's coach Ivan Lendl, stepped down as Murray's coach during the Sony Open. Murray and Lendl said the decision was mutual, but that was the case only because Lendl decided he was going to pursue his own pursuits at the expense of traveling with Murray.

So Murray, who lost a controversial quarterfinals match to Novak Djokovic at the Sony Open, solicited advice about his next mentor on the social media site.

Murray got some interesting answers - some amusing, some food for thought.

Lendl helped Murray with his mental approach during matches. If Sampras had any interest, Murray should pursue to the ends of the earth. And if Sampras is unavailable, an intriguing alternative is Navratilova, whose also knows a thing or two about mental strength.

John McEnroe and Bjorn Borg also are interesting answers.
